Как добавить стили к шаблонам столбцов в Amcharts Treemap? - PullRequest
1 голос
/ 26 апреля 2019

Я хочу добавить маржинальное оформление для шаблона столбца уровня 1 в диаграмме TreeMap Amcharts v4.

Я пробовал следующий код, но известный из них работает.

level0ColumnTemplate.column.marginTop   = 30;
level0ColumnTemplate.marginTop   = 30;

кодСсылка: http://jsfiddle.net/t42asecw/3/

1 Ответ

0 голосов
/ 27 апреля 2019

Похоже, вы пытаетесь создать вертикальное пространство между столбцами древовидной карты.Не может сделать это на реальных сериях columns.template, потому что эти пытаются занять как можно больше места .Тогда вы можете попробовать поставить paddingTop на column, например:

level1ColumnTemplate.column.paddingTop = 30;

// Don't forget to shift bullet, too
bullet1.dy = 15;

Вилка вашего кода:

http://jsfiddle.net/notacouch/2vrk3e6s/

Или, если вам нужно равномерное расстояние со всех сторон, вы можете увеличить strokeWidth, просто обязательно увеличьте также значения column.cornerRadius* (если ваши углы вообще закруглены):

level1ColumnTemplate.column.cornerRadius(30, 30, 30, 30)
level1ColumnTemplate.strokeWidth = 30;
...